#1a0bac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#1a0bac is composed of 10.2% red, 4.3% green and 67.5%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 84.9% cyan, 93.6% magenta, 0% yellow and 32.5% black. It has a hue angle of 245.6 degrees, a saturation of 88% and a lightness of 35.9%. #1a0bac color hex could be obtained by blending #3416ff with #000059. Closest websafe color is: #330099.

#1a0bac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#1a0bac has RGB values of R:26, G:11, B:172 and CMYK values of C:0.85, M:0.94, Y:0, K:0.33. Its decimal value is 1706924.
